How much do electrical apprentice part time jobs pay per hour?

As of Sep 6, 2026, the average hourly pay for electrical apprentice part time in Dallas, TX is $22.57,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$18.08 and $24.95 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is an electrical apprentice part time?

Electrical Apprentice Part Time positions are entry-level roles for individuals learning the electrical trade while working limited hours. Apprentices assist licensed electricians with tasks such as installing, maintaining, and repairing electrical systems, often while attending classes or training programs. These roles are designed to provide practical, hands-on experience and help apprentices fulfill the requirements for becoming a licensed electrician. Working part-time allows flexibility for balancing work, education, or other commitments. Apprentices typically work under close supervision and gradually take on more responsibility as they gain skills and experience.

What types of projects and tasks can I expect to work on as an electrical apprentice part time?

As a part-time Electrical Apprentice, you’ll typically assist licensed electricians with tasks such as running conduit, pulling wire, installing outlets and fixtures, and performing routine maintenance. You’ll gain hands-on experience in both residential and commercial settings, depending on your employer. Part-time apprentices often rotate through different job sites and responsibilities, allowing you to develop a broad skill set while balancing work with other commitments like school or family. You’ll also collaborate closely with journeymen and senior electricians, learning industry best practices and safety standards.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an electrical apprentice part time,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Electrical Apprentice Part Time, you need a basic understanding of electrical systems, safety protocols, and often a high school diploma or equivalent. Familiarity with hand tools, electrical testing equipment, and knowledge of National Electrical Code (NEC) standards are typically required. Reliability, attention to detail, and a willingness to learn are key soft skills that help apprentices succeed in both independent and team settings. These skills and qualities are crucial for ensuring safety, quality workmanship, and effective career development in the electrical trade.

What is the difference between Electrical Apprentice Part Time vs Electrical Journeyman?

AspectElectrical Apprentice Part TimeElectrical Journeyman
Required CredentialsHigh school diploma, apprenticeship programCompleted apprenticeship, journeyman license
Work EnvironmentTraining sites, construction, residentialSupervising, installing, troubleshooting
Employer & Industry UsageConstruction companies, electrical contractorsElectrical contractors, maintenance firms

Electrical Apprentice Part Time roles are entry-level positions focused on learning and gaining experience, often with flexible hours. Journeymen are fully qualified electricians responsible for complex tasks and supervising apprentices. The main difference lies in certification, experience, and job responsibilities, with apprentices still in training and journeymen having completed their certification and gained full independence.

Job Summary

Summary:  The Licensed Master Plumber holds the license that all other technicians in that trade will work under for the system and is responsible for ensuring that all work is performed according to all applicable laws, federal, state and local. In addition, this role may be called upon to supervise and lead a group of workers on a project, teach advanced maintenance skills to other members of the department, review work of outside vendors and licensed maintenance workers, and report on and repair discrepancies, as assigned.

Essential Duties and Responsibilities:

  • Installs, modifies, and repairs plumbing systems in accordance with local plumbing codes and company standards.
  • Cuts, assembles, and installs pipes and fittings for water, gas, drainage, and waste systems.
  • Reads and understands blueprints, specifications, or models to learn work layout, or plans own work layout, making routine computations as needed. 
  • Performs layout and routing of systems using best practices and job site coordination.
  • Performs pressure tests, leak checks, and system flushing.
  • Maintains the systems, equipment, and facilities, in a clean safe operating condition in accordance with local, state and federal regulations as they relate to the plumbing trade. 
  • Collaborates with other trades to ensure coordinated system installation.
  • Maintains logs, performs rounds, and makes recommendations for modification or improvement of preventive maintenance systems. 
  • Uses hand and power tools safely and efficiently.
  • Contributes to a safe work environment by quickly reporting accidents and unsafe working conditions. 
  • Performs other duties as assigned.

Qualifications:

  • High school diploma or equivalent 8 years (minimum) of training and work experience, including 4 years in a DOL accredited Apprentice Program plus 4 years working as a Journeyman Plumber.
  • Must have a valid Master’s Plumbing license as well as proof of a valid RMP endorsement.  
  • Must possess a valid Class “C” driver’s license.
  • Rudimentary ability to utilize hand-operated construction equipment.
  • Ability to repeatedly lift 50 pounds and kneel/bend/stoop and perform strenuous labor for extended periods of time.

Working Conditions:  

  • Some exposure to elevated degrees of high heat, noise, dust, dirt and/or areas requiring infection control. Requires meeting deadlines for completion of work on a daily basis. Must be able to work all hours, including weekends and nights, as necessary, in order to maintain facility at the appropriate and safe level.
